Zusammenfassung: | The invention discloses a discrete interest point gridding earth observation planning method and device, and belongs to the technical field of satellite earth observation task planning. The method comprises the following steps: performing H3 mesh generation and coding on global geographic information according to a set H3 spatial index hierarchy to obtain a mesh set of an observation area under the H3 spatial index hierarchy; based on the interest level of each interest point in the grid Grid, calculating the popularity weight of the grid Grid; according to a satellite orbit of the satellite Satk, obtaining a strip Skg of the satellite Satk in an observation area, and obtaining a value xikg of a decision variable corresponding to the grid Gridi by judging whether the grid Gridi obtains coverage of the strip Skg under the satellite Satk; and based on the value xikg of the decision variable and the popularity weight, constructing and solving an optimization problem of the sum of the weights of the coverage grid |
